Ūdrai
Ūdrai is a village in Naujamiesčio sen., Panevėžys District Municipality, Panevėžys County. Ūdrai is situated nearby to the village Vadaktėliai, as well as near Laužupis.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Garšviai
Village
Garšviai is a village near Naujamiestis in Panevėžys District Municipality, Lithuania. According to the 2011 census, it had seven residents. It is known as the locations of the Garšviai Book Smuggling Society, one of the largest illegal societies of Lithuanian book smugglers during the Lithuanian press ban.
